Execution Constraints
- DO NOT use the competitor's trademarked name in the title, subtitle, or promotional text.
- DO NOT use generic marketing fluff (e.g., "The ultimate app for everything"). Use sharp, specific claims.
- DO NOT hallucinate features for the user's app. If a competitor complains about "offline mode" but the user's app doesn't have it, do not mention offline mode. Only attack where you have the high ground.
- DO adhere strictly to the character limits for Titles (30 chars) and Subtitles (30 chars).
